Trusted Boot CVE-2017-16837 Local Arbitrary Code Execution Vulnerability

Bugtraq ID: 105204
Class: Design Error
CVE: CVE-2017-16837
Remote: No
Local: Yes
Published: Nov 15 2017 12:00AM
Updated: Nov 15 2017 12:00AM
Credit: Seunghun Han, Wook Shin, Jun-Hyeok Park, and HyoungChun Kim of National Security Research Institute
Vulnerable: Trusted Computing Group Trusted Platform Module (TPM) 2.0
Trusted Boot Project Trusted Boot 1.9.6
Trusted Boot Project Trusted Boot 1.9.4
Trusted Boot Project Trusted Boot 1.8
Trusted Boot Project Trusted Boot 1.7.2
Trusted Boot Project Trusted Boot 1.7.3-rc1
